Tapeworm infestations from eating raw salmon triples
It's small, only 1 per 100,000, up from 0.32 per 100,000.

Gotta start swiping "fresh fish is good sashimi fish" from my friends' minds.According to U.S. Food and Drug Administration regulations, all fish meant to be served as sushi must be frozen for a specified period of time (usually a week) to kill lurking parasites.
Rennie said no matter how fresh, unless you're buying certified "sushi grade" fish it's best not to try to serve it raw at home.
Symptoms of Tapeworm Infection
The symptoms of tapeworm infection are:
* Nausea
* Diarrhea
* Abnominal pain or discomfort
* Hunger
* Fatigue
